1. Virtual Assistant
Becoming a virtual assistant is one of the most straightforward online jobs available. This role typically involves providing administrative support to businesses or entrepreneurs, including tasks like scheduling, email management, and social media coordination. The demand for virtual assistants is growing, making it a viable option for those looking to work from home with flexible hours.
Pros:
High demand for services.
Flexible working hours.
Cons:
Requires good organizational skills.
2. Online Surveys
Participating in online surveys is an easy way to earn extra cash. While it won't replace a full-time income, sites like Swagbucks and Branded Surveys allow users to complete surveys in exchange for rewards or cash. This method is particularly appealing because it requires no special skills and can be done in your spare time.
Pros:
Simple tasks that anyone can do.
No prior experience is needed.
Cons:
Earnings are generally low.
3. Freelance Writing
If you have a knack for writing, freelance writing offers a great opportunity to earn money online. You can write articles, blog posts, or even copy for businesses. Websites like Upwork and Fiverr connect freelancers with clients looking for content creators. This job can be quite lucrative depending on your expertise and the niches you target.
Pros:
Potentially high earnings.
Flexibility in choosing projects.
Cons:
Competitive market; building a portfolio takes time.
4. Online Tutoring
Online tutoring has become increasingly popular, especially with the rise of remote learning. If you have expertise in a particular subject, you can teach students through platforms like VIPKid or Tutor.com. This job not only pays well but also allows you to share your knowledge with others.
Pros:
High hourly rates.
A rewarding experience helping students.
Cons:
Requires subject knowledge and teaching skills.
5. Microtasks
Completing microtasks through platforms like Amazon Mechanical Turk or Clickworker is another easy way to earn money online. These tasks can include data entry, image tagging, or simple surveys. While the pay per task is low, they are quick to complete and can add up over time.
Pros:
Flexible and easy to start.
No special skills are required.
Cons:
Earnings are modest and inconsistent.
6. Blogging
Starting a blog can be both fulfilling and profitable if done correctly. By creating content around a niche you’re passionate about, you can monetize through ads, affiliate marketing, or selling products. While it requires initial effort to build an audience, successful bloggers can earn substantial income over time.
Pros:
Potential for passive income.
Creative outlet.
Cons:
Takes time to establish traffic and revenue streams.
